As a member of the Contract Manufacturing Procurement team, reporting to the Senior Procurement Manager for Contract Manufacturing, the intern will focus on initiatives directly tied to the sourcing, selection, and management of contract manufacturing partners. The role centers on supporting procurement activities such as cost analysis, supplier onboarding, contractual negotiations, and ensuring continuous improvement in suppliers performance.
A key focus of the role will be to review and evaluate Danone’s Global procurement tools, highlight best practices, and identify ways to adapt these tools and processes to fit the specific needs of our team. The intern will be expected to proactively identify and communicate any gaps or challenges these global tools may present within the Canadian market context, ensuring that our procurement operations remain agile and effective.
